Frank Leboeuf believes his former club, Chelsea, should consider bringing Granit Xhaka back to the Premier League by signing the Bayer Leverkusen midfielder this summer.

Such a move would undoubtedly stir emotions in North London, as the Swiss star played nearly 300 games for Arsenal from 2016 to 2023.

Xhaka departed the Emirates for Germany last year and had an exceptional season under Xabi Alonso, winning both the Bundesliga and the DFB Pokal.

Leboeuf sees the 31-year-old as an ideal addition to Chelsea’s midfield and thinks the club should pursue Xhaka during this transfer window.

While there is no indication that this move is currently being considered, the Frenchman remains enthusiastic about the prospect.

“I believe Chelsea should sign Granit Xhaka. He’s incredibly impressive, and I think they missed an opportunity when he left Arsenal,” Leboeuf told BoyleSports. “He has been phenomenal for Switzerland at the EUROs and was also Leverkusen’s Player of the Season. He would fit perfectly into Chelsea’s midfield alongside Enzo and Caicedo. He could be the missing piece of the puzzle for them.”

While Chelsea is likely focusing on acquiring a new striker this summer, with Napoli star Victor Osimhen being linked, Leboeuf has also recommended a few other options.

“I highly rate Victor Osimhen and feel he would be an excellent striker for Chelsea,” Leboeuf said. “He’s strong, good in the air, and a natural goal-scorer despite some issues last season.”

Leboeuf also suggests that Chelsea should consider strikers from Lens and Lille, who have historically been successful in developing and selling top strikers for significant profits. “Jonathan David and Lois Openda have been superb in the French league and did not cost much. If I were Chelsea, I would look at signing Elhi Wahi from Lens. He is a quality player and could have a similar impact to Drogba, who joined from Marseille for a bargain fee.”
